Update: Notice of changes to the AIM Small Joint Surgery Guideline
Effective March 14, 2021, the AIM Small Joint Surgery Guideline has been updated with the following:
- Clarified requirements for imaging reports.
- Removed radiographic requirement for confirmation of lesser toe deformities.
- Ankle arthrodesis and total ankle arthroplasty added as new indications for revision of failed previous reconstructions.
- Removed total ankle arthroplasty requirements for adjacent joint or inflammatory arthritis.
- Clarified contraindications only apply to total ankle arthroplasty.
